Key Takeaways:
1. Your habits define your success. Small, daily actions compound over time.
2. Mindset matters. Reframe failure as learning, and practice gratitude to stay positive.
3. Plan your success. Structure your day, set priorities, and track progress.
4. Energy fuels achievement. Sleep, movement, and nutrition impact focus and motivation.
5. Success is a team effort. Build strong relationships and surround yourself with positive influences.
6. Growth happens outside your comfort zone. Challenge yourself daily and embrace persistence.
